WebThe PROC FREQ is one of the most frequently used SAS procedures which helps to summarize categorical variable. It calculates count/frequency and cumulative frequency of categories of a categorical variable. The 'Cumulative Frequency' and 'Cumulative Percenr are simply running totals. For PAIN = 1, the cumulative frequency of 21 means that 21 cases have a PAIN value of 1 or 0. ... WebCumulative frequency is defined as a running total of frequencies. The frequency. of an element in a set refers to how many of that element there are in the set. Cumulative frequency can also defined as the sum of all previous frequencies up. to the current point. The first quartile was 13; the second quartile was 17, and the third quartile was 18. great wolf pocono paWebExample 11 : Generate Bar Chart and Dot Plot The bar chart can be generated with PROC FREQ. To produce a bar chart for variable 'y', the plots=freqplot (type=bar) option is added. By default, it shows frequency in graph. In order to show percent, you need to add scale=percent.
